Light Green spot of Glory in your Aquarium
These little beauties are a great contrast to darker greens of the Mosses and Java Ferns and they are a breeze to grow. They were suggested as something Goldfish would not eat but the suggester was mistaken. Gold fish devoured them but no worries. As they floated to the top mostly eaten, I removed what was left and let it float around in one of the shrimp tanks and when roots appeared, put it in the substrate and it took off again. So if you are looking for a eye catching spot of color in your Aquarium, look no further than this great little plant.
